📖 Overview
Way Bandy (1941-1986) was an influential American makeup artist and author who helped revolutionize cosmetic application techniques in the 1970s. He worked extensively with top models and celebrities, and his distinctive style graced numerous magazine covers including Vogue, Harper's Bazaar, and Cosmopolitan.
Bandy authored two significant books on makeup artistry: "Designing Your Face" (1977) and "Styling Your Face" (1981). These works became essential references for both professional makeup artists and the general public, introducing innovative concepts like contouring and color theory to mainstream audiences.
Bandy developed what became known as "The Bandy Look," which emphasized enhancing natural features through precise blending and strategic placement of cosmetics. His techniques focused on creating sculptural effects with makeup, treating the face as a canvas while working with individual bone structure and features.
His influence on the beauty industry continued well beyond his death from AIDS-related complications in 1986. Bandy's methods and philosophy regarding makeup application continue to influence modern makeup artists and remain relevant in contemporary beauty culture.

📚 Books by Way Bandy
Designing Your Face (1977)
A detailed manual of makeup application techniques, focusing on how to work with individual facial features and create personalized looks.
Styling Your Face (1981) A guide to makeup application that emphasizes creating different looks based on facial structure and adapting techniques for various occasions and lighting conditions.
